(2) Operating Procedure
Use the following procedure.
Step Display after Operation Keys Operation
1
Press the Key to view the main menu for the
utility function.
Use the or Key to move through the list and
select Fn01E.
2
Press the Key.
The display changes to the Fn01E execution display.
The SERVOPACK ID information is displayed. Use
the or Key to scroll left and right and to
view other information.
3
Press the Key.
The servomotor ID information is displayed. Use the
or Key to scroll left and right and to view
other information.
4
Press the Key.
The encoder ID information is displayed.
Use the or Key to scroll left and right and to
view other information.
5
Press the Key.
The display returns to the main menu of the utility
function.
